velkropie Posted June 25, 2007 Share Posted June 25, 2007 Hey, i have succesfully installed 10.4.8(Jas) into this laptop Lenovo ThinkPad R60 9457. sudo nano /Library/Preferences/SystemConfiguration/NetworkInterfaces.plist and changed the en0 to en2. <key>Interfaces</key> <array> <dict> <key>BSD Name</key> <string>en2</string> <key>IOBuiltin</key> <false/> <key>IOInterfaceType</key> <integer>6</integer> <key>IOInterfaceUnit</key> <integer>2</integer> <key>IOLocation</key> <string></string> <key>IOMACAddress</key> <data> ABbTSNWo </data> <key>IOPathMatch</key> <string>IOService:/AppleACPIPlatformExpert/PCI0@0/AppleACPIPCI/PCIB@1E/IOPCI2PCIBridge/LANB@7/com_apple_driver_RTL8139/IOEthernetInterface</string> </dict> i followed this guide... http://forum.insanelymac.com/index.php?sho...mp;#entry238508 then sudo nano /System/Library/Extensions/IO80211Family.kext/Contents/PlugIns/AirPortAtheros5424.kext/Contents/Info.plist and added Find <key>IONameMatch</key> and change it to : (delete the old value) <array> <string>pci106b,0086</string> <string>pci106b,1c</string> <string>pci168c,1c</string> <string>pci168c,1014</string> <string>pci168c,13</string> <string>pci168c,14</string> <string>pci168c,15</string> <string>pci168c,16</string> <string>pci168c,17</string> <string>pci168c,18</string> <string>pci168c,19</string> <string>pci168c,1a</string> <string>pci168c,1b</string> <string>pci168c,1c</string> <string>pci168c,52</string> <string>pci168c,55</string> <string>pci168c,57</string> <string>pci168c,58</string> <string>pci168c,58a</string> <string>pci168c,86</string> <string>pci168c,87</string> <string>pci168c,0013</string> </array> follow the guides for loading it and it worked great!!! thanks for posting such great and easy to follow guides!!!
